I saw this posted on another Stony Brook Class of 2020 thread:
"Hello Fellow Applicants!
I interviewed earlier this week. The interview consisted of 4-5 questions and took exactly an hour. According to the coordinator and interviewers, all applicants have been invited to interview (160 interviewees and 80 seats to fill). There were 800 applicants and they will be taking 10%. About 10 minutes after the interview you are brought into another room and start a writing sample (25 minutes) immediately followed by a 25 minute math assessment (decimals, fractions, percentages and knowing how to divide and subtract them - exactly what they say in the email they send out with the interview invitation).
Hope this helps to calm some nerves. Good luck!"
